news 2026/4/16 18:30:42

音乐播放修复与音源配置技术指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
音乐播放修复与音源配置技术指南

音乐播放修复与音源配置技术指南

【免费下载链接】New_lxmusic_source六音音源修复版项目地址: https://gitcode.com/gh_mirrors/ne/New_lxmusic_source

音乐播放修复是音频服务优化的重要环节,尤其对于使用洛雪音乐客户端的用户而言,音源配置不当可能导致播放异常。本文提供一套系统化的技术方案,涵盖问题定位、配置流程及性能调优,帮助技术人员和普通用户解决音乐播放问题,优化音频服务质量。

问题定位与分析

常见播放异常表现

  • 音频文件加载失败
  • 播放过程中频繁卡顿或中断
  • 音质失真或音频格式不支持
  • 应用程序无响应或崩溃

技术原理简析

洛雪音乐客户端通过音源插件获取音乐资源,音源插件本质上是实现特定接口的JavaScript模块。当客户端升级或音源接口变更时,可能导致现有音源插件与客户端不兼容,表现为各类播放异常。

环境兼容性检查

在进行音源配置前,需确认以下环境条件:

  • 洛雪音乐客户端版本 ≥ 1.2.0
  • Node.js 运行环境 ≥ 14.0.0
  • 系统内存 ≥ 2GB
  • 网络连接稳定,延迟 < 200ms

音源配置流程

环境准备

  1. 克隆项目仓库

    git clone https://gitcode.com/gh_mirrors/ne/New_lxmusic_source.git cd New_lxmusic_source
  2. 验证文件完整性

    md5sum sixyin-music-source-v1.0.7.js

    注意事项:请确保校验值与项目发布页提供的哈希值一致,避免使用被篡改的文件。

插件安装

  1. 启动洛雪音乐客户端
  2. 导航至设置界面(快捷键:Ctrl+,)
  3. 在左侧导航栏选择"插件管理"
  4. 点击"安装本地插件"按钮
  5. 浏览并选择项目目录中的sixyin-music-source-v1.0.7.js文件
  6. 点击"确认安装"并等待插件加载完成
  7. 重启客户端使配置生效

基础验证

  1. 在客户端搜索栏输入任意关键词
  2. 观察搜索结果加载速度(正常应 < 3秒)
  3. 选择任意音乐进行播放测试
  4. 检查播放进度条是否正常更新
  5. 验证音量控制功能是否正常

性能调优策略

缓存机制优化

  1. 调整缓存目录位置

    • 进入"设置 > 高级 > 缓存设置"
    • 选择剩余空间 > 20GB的磁盘分区
    • 设置缓存上限为可用空间的30%
  2. 缓存清理策略

    每日自动清理:缓存文件超过7天未访问 空间预警清理:当缓存占用超过设定上限的90%时 手动清理:通过"工具 > 清理缓存"立即执行

网络请求优化

  1. 连接池配置

    • 最大并发连接数:8
    • 连接超时时间:15秒
    • 重试次数:2次
  2. 请求优先级设置

    • 播放中音频:最高优先级
    • 预加载音频:中优先级
    • 封面图片:低优先级

音频解码优化

  1. 解码器选择

    • 对于无损音频:使用FLAC解码器
    • 对于普通音频:使用AAC解码器
    • 低性能设备:启用硬件加速解码
  2. 音质调节

    • 采样率:44.1kHz(标准CD音质)
    • 比特率:320kbps(平衡音质与带宽)
    • 声道模式:立体声(默认)

高级配置选项

多音源负载均衡

  1. 启用多音源模式

    • 在插件设置中勾选"启用多音源协同"
    • 添加备用音源文件sixyin-music-source-backup.js
    • 设置主备切换阈值:连续3次请求失败自动切换
  2. 资源分配策略

    主音源:承担70%请求负载 备用音源:承担30%请求负载 故障转移:主音源不可用时自动切换至备用

日志与监控配置

  1. 日志级别设置

    • 调试模式:DEBUG
    • 生产模式:INFO
    • 排错模式:ERROR
  2. 关键指标监控

    • 请求成功率(目标:>99%)
    • 平均响应时间(目标:<500ms)
    • 缓存命中率(目标:>80%)

故障排除与恢复

排错流程

  1. 检查应用日志

    • 日志路径:~/.lxmusic/logs/
    • 关键日志文件:app.logplugin.log
  2. 常见问题解决方案

    问题现象可能原因解决措施
    无法加载音源文件权限不足chmod 644 sixyin-music-source-v1.0.7.js
    播放卡顿网络不稳定启用本地缓存或切换网络
    无搜索结果API接口变更更新至最新版本音源文件
  3. 恢复操作

    • 重置配置:删除~/.lxmusic/config.json后重启
    • 插件重置:卸载并重新安装音源插件
    • 完全恢复:备份数据后重新安装客户端

版本控制建议

  1. 建立版本管理机制

    • 使用Git跟踪音源文件变更
    • 重要版本打上标签(如v1.0.7-stable)
    • 维护CHANGELOG记录功能变更
  2. 更新策略

    • 主版本更新:手动确认后执行
    • 次版本更新:自动更新但保留回滚选项
    • 紧急修复:提供热修复通道

注意事项

  1. 安全性考量

    • 仅从官方渠道获取音源文件
    • 定期扫描文件完整性
    • 避免在公共网络环境下进行配置
  2. 法律合规

    • 确保使用符合版权要求的音乐资源
    • 遵守各音乐平台的服务条款
    • 合理使用缓存功能,避免侵犯知识产权
  3. 性能监控

    • 定期检查CPU和内存占用
    • 监控网络带宽使用情况
    • 记录异常播放事件并分析原因

通过本指南提供的系统化方法,用户可以有效解决音乐播放问题,优化音源配置,并掌握音频服务优化的核心技术。建议定期查看项目更新日志,保持系统组件的兼容性和安全性。

【免费下载链接】New_lxmusic_source六音音源修复版项目地址: https://gitcode.com/gh_mirrors/ne/New_lxmusic_source

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 15:22:44

新手必看:RISC-V中断使能位配置方法

以下是对您提供的博文内容进行 深度润色与结构重构后的技术文章 。我以一位深耕RISC-V嵌入式开发多年、常年带团队做BSP/RTOS移植的工程师视角&#xff0c;彻底重写了全文—— 去掉所有AI腔调、模板化标题和空泛总结&#xff0c;代之以真实项目中的思考脉络、踩坑现场、调试…

作者头像 李华
网站建设 2026/4/15 14:42:31

主流抠图模型横评:cv_unet、MODNet、PortraitNet部署体验

主流抠图模型横评&#xff1a;cv_unet、MODNet、PortraitNet部署体验 1. 为什么需要一次真实的抠图模型横向对比&#xff1f; 你是不是也遇到过这些情况&#xff1a; 想给电商产品换纯白背景&#xff0c;结果边缘毛边明显&#xff0c;客户说“这图看着假”&#xff1b;做社交…

作者头像 李华
网站建设 2026/4/16 13:49:10

Realtime Voice Changer探索者指南:从入门到精通的实时语音转换技术

Realtime Voice Changer探索者指南&#xff1a;从入门到精通的实时语音转换技术 【免费下载链接】voice-changer リアルタイムボイスチェンジャー Realtime Voice Changer 项目地址: https://gitcode.com/gh_mirrors/vo/voice-changer 声音转换的痛点与解决方案 在数字…

作者头像 李华
网站建设 2026/4/16 13:48:59

【Rockchip RK3576】边缘计算与 AIoT 领域的全能架构深度解析

在人工智能物联网&#xff08;AIoT&#xff09;飞速发展的背景下&#xff0c;边缘计算设备对高性能、低功耗以及强大 AI 推理能力的需求日益迫切。瑞芯微&#xff08;Rockchip&#xff09;推出的 RK3576 作为其第二代高性能 AIoT 平台&#xff0c;凭借先进的 8nm 工艺、八核处理…

作者头像 李华
网站建设 2026/4/16 10:49:14

NS-USBLoader高效指南:Switch文件管理与RCM payload注入实用教程

NS-USBLoader高效指南&#xff1a;Switch文件管理与RCM payload注入实用教程 【免费下载链接】ns-usbloader Awoo Installer and GoldLeaf uploader of the NSPs (and other files), RCM payload injector, application for split/merge files. 项目地址: https://gitcode.co…

作者头像 李华